Portuguese Man has 5kg Tumour Removed From Face

October 21st, 2010 - 11:07 pm ICT by Angela Kaye Mason  

Oct 21 (THAINDIAN NEWS) A man from Portugal has underwent major surgery to have a tumor which weighed 5 kgs removed from his face. Jose Mestre was in a Chicago hospital for three months in order to have the procedure done, which should help him to eat and sleep better as well as improve his breathing.

A report from ‘ABC” reveals that doctors had determined Mestre would have died without the surgery. The translator for the 54 year old stated, “He finally has a chance to lead sort of a normal life because before he felt that, even though he never chose to, he was the center of attraction wherever he went.”

The growth began to form on his face when he was just fourteen years old, and he became to be known as “the man without a face”. Doctors say that it will still be at least a year before it is clear whether or not he will fully recover, but they remain hopeful, as does his family.
